news 2026/5/12 19:12:23

如何实现医院号源智能监控:91160-cli自动化挂号系统深度解析

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
如何实现医院号源智能监控:91160-cli自动化挂号系统深度解析

如何实现医院号源智能监控:91160-cli自动化挂号系统深度解析

【免费下载链接】91160-cli健康160全自动挂号脚本,捡漏神器项目地址: https://gitcode.com/gh_mirrors/91/91160-cli

还在为医院挂号难而烦恼吗?91160-cli是一款基于Java开发的医院号源监控系统,能够智能检测医生排班信息,实现自动化挂号抢号,让您轻松应对医疗预约的挑战。这款工具通过智能算法和多重优化策略,解决了传统人工挂号效率低下的问题,为技术爱好者和需要频繁就医的用户提供了专业级的解决方案。

🎯 核心价值:告别熬夜排队,拥抱智能医疗

在医疗资源紧张的今天,热门医生的号源往往在几秒钟内被抢购一空。91160-cli通过技术创新实现了以下核心价值:

🚀 效率提升:24小时不间断监控号源状态,无需人工值守🎯 精准识别:智能分析医生排班信息,自动筛选可用时间段🛡️ 稳定可靠:内置重试机制和代理支持,应对网络波动⚙️ 高度可配:支持多种刷号策略和定时任务,适应不同场景

📊 核心特性展示

91160-cli提供了丰富的功能模块,满足各种医疗预约需求:

🔍 智能监控能力

  • 多通道刷号策略:支持科室排班页和医生详情页双通道监控
  • 实时号源检测:毫秒级响应时间,第一时间发现号源变化
  • 智能过滤机制:自动排除不可用时间段和医生

⚙️ 高级配置选项

  • 定时挂号功能:预设抢号时间,系统自动执行
  • 代理网络支持:多线路尝试,提高成功率
  • 自定义休眠间隔:根据网络环境调整刷号频率
  • 验证码自动处理:集成多种OCR平台,无需人工干预

📈 性能优化特性

  • 资源高效利用:低内存占用,长时间稳定运行
  • 错误自动恢复:网络异常时自动重连和重试
  • 日志详细记录:完整的操作日志,便于问题排查

加入91160-cli技术交流群,获取最新使用技巧和社区支持

🚀 3步快速部署指南

第一步:环境准备与获取

# 克隆项目到本地 git clone https://gitcode.com/gh_mirrors/91/91160-cli # 进入项目目录 cd 91160-cli

第二步:初始化配置

# 使用Docker快速初始化(推荐) docker run --rm \ -v $PWD/config:/app/config \ -e APP_CMD='init' \ -e APP_CMD_ARGS='-c config/config.properties' \ -it pengpan/91160-cli:latest

第三步:启动监控服务

# 启动挂号监控服务 docker run --name 91160-cli \ -v $PWD/config:/app/config \ -v $PWD/logs:/app/logs \ -e APP_CMD='register' \ -e APP_CMD_ARGS='-c config/config.properties' \ -d pengpan/91160-cli:latest

⚙️ 高级配置与调优

核心配置文件详解

配置文件位于 config/config.properties,以下是关键参数说明:

# 刷号休眠时间(单位:毫秒) sleepTime=3000 # 刷号起始日期(格式:yyyy-MM-dd) brushStartDate=2023-10-01 # 定时挂号设置 enableAppoint=true appointTime=2023-10-15 08:00:00 # 刷号通道选择 brushChannel=CHANNEL_1 # 代理配置 enableProxy=true proxyFilePath=proxy.txt proxyMode=ROUND_ROBIN

代理文件格式

代理配置文件支持HTTP和SOCKS协议:

http@127.0.0.1:1087 socks@127.0.0.1:1086 http@proxy.example.com:8080

系统架构解析

91160-cli采用模块化设计,主要模块包括:

  • 核心服务层:src/main/java/com/github/pengpan/service/ - 业务逻辑处理
  • 客户端层:src/main/java/com/github/pengpan/client/ - 网络请求封装
  • 配置管理层:src/main/java/com/github/pengpan/common/store/ - 配置持久化
  • 工具类:src/main/java/com/github/pengpan/util/ - 通用工具函数

🏥 实战应用场景

场景一:专家号智能抢号

需求:预约某三甲医院专家门诊,放号时间为每周一上午8点配置方案

enableAppoint=true appointTime=2023-10-16 07:59:50 sleepTime=1000 brushChannel=

工作原理

  1. 系统在放号前10秒启动监控
  2. 双通道同时检测号源变化
  3. 检测到号源后立即提交预约请求
  4. 自动完成验证码识别和表单提交

场景二:慢性病定期复诊

需求:每月固定时间预约同一医生复诊配置方案

brushStartDate=2023-10-01 sleepTime=5000 enableProxy=true proxyMode=RANDOM

优势

  • 自动轮询未来一周的号源
  • 代理随机切换避免IP限制
  • 较低的刷号频率减少服务器压力

扫描二维码添加微信,获取一对一技术支持

🛠️ 性能优化技巧

网络优化策略

  1. 代理轮询机制:通过多IP轮询避免单一IP被限制
  2. 请求间隔优化:根据目标网站响应时间调整休眠间隔
  3. 连接池管理:复用HTTP连接减少握手开销

内存与CPU优化

// 核心源码示例:智能休眠策略 public void brushTicketTask(Config config) { while (true) { try { // 执行刷号逻辑 boolean success = executeBrush(config); if (success) { log.info("挂号成功!"); break; } // 智能休眠,根据网络状况调整 ThreadUtil.sleep(config.getSleepTime()); } catch (Exception e) { log.error("刷号异常,等待重试", e); ThreadUtil.sleep(5000); // 异常时延长等待时间 } } }

日志分析与监控

系统提供详细的日志输出,便于问题排查:

  • INFO级别:正常操作记录,监控运行状态
  • WARN级别:网络波动或临时错误,需要关注
  • ERROR级别:系统异常,需要立即处理

🔧 开发者进阶指南

编译与自定义开发

# 使用Maven编译项目 ./build.sh # 运行自定义版本 java -jar target/91160-cli-jar-with-dependencies.jar \ register -c config/config.properties

扩展开发接口

91160-cli提供了清晰的接口设计,便于功能扩展:

// 自定义刷号策略示例 public interface TicketService { ScheduleInfo getScheduleInfo(Config config); boolean submitAppointment(Config config, ScheduleInfo scheduleInfo); } // 实现自定义验证码识别 public interface CaptchaService { CapRegResult capReg(BufferedImage captchaImage); CapJustResult capJust(String requestId); }

集成第三方服务

系统支持多种OCR平台集成:

  • DDDD OCR:开源验证码识别库
  • Fateadm:商业验证码识别服务
  • 自定义OCR:支持扩展其他识别平台

📊 系统对比与选型建议

特性91160-cli传统人工挂号其他自动化工具
监控频率毫秒级分钟级秒级
成功率95%+依赖运气80%-90%
配置灵活性高度可配置无配置有限配置
技术要求中等
成本免费开源时间成本高可能有费用

🚨 注意事项与最佳实践

合规使用建议

  1. 遵守医院规定:确保使用频率在合理范围内
  2. 尊重医疗资源:避免过度占用号源
  3. 个人使用:仅限本人或直系亲属使用

技术注意事项

  1. 网络环境:确保稳定的网络连接
  2. 系统时间:保持系统时间准确
  3. 资源监控:定期检查系统资源使用情况

故障排除

问题:Windows系统中文乱码解决方案

# 设置终端编码 chcp 65001 # 指定Java编码 java -Dfile.encoding=utf-8 -jar 91160-cli.jar init

问题:代理连接失败解决方案

  1. 检查代理文件格式是否正确
  2. 验证代理服务器是否可用
  3. 尝试切换代理模式

如果您觉得91160-cli对您有帮助,可以扫描二维码支持开发者

🌟 总结与展望

91160-cli作为一款专业的医院号源监控工具,通过技术创新解决了医疗预约中的效率问题。其自动化挂号系统不仅提高了成功率,还大大减轻了用户的等待压力。

核心优势回顾: ✅智能监控:24小时不间断号源检测 ✅多重策略:支持多种刷号通道和代理模式 ✅高度可配:丰富的配置选项满足不同需求 ✅稳定可靠:完善的错误处理和重试机制 ✅开源免费:基于MIT协议,完全免费使用

未来发展方向

  1. AI智能预测:基于历史数据分析号源释放规律
  2. 多平台支持:扩展支持更多医院预约系统
  3. 移动端适配:开发手机客户端方便随时监控

无论是技术爱好者想要学习自动化技术,还是需要频繁就医的用户寻求效率提升,91160-cli都提供了完整的解决方案。通过合理的配置和使用,您将能够轻松应对各种医疗预约挑战。

加入91160-cli最终版交流群,获取最新更新和技术支持

立即开始您的智能医疗预约之旅,让技术为您守护健康!

【免费下载链接】91160-cli健康160全自动挂号脚本,捡漏神器项目地址: https://gitcode.com/gh_mirrors/91/91160-cli

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/12 19:10:08

构建AI助手本地评估循环:从800次交互中量化提示词工程与模型优化

1. 项目缘起:为什么我的AI助手需要一个本地评估循环?作为一名深度依赖AI工具进行日常工作的从业者,我使用个人AI助手处理从代码审查、文档撰写到创意构思的方方面面。起初,它就像一个反应迅速但略显“健忘”的同事——每次对话都是…

作者头像 李华
网站建设 2026/5/12 19:07:56

WeChatMsg技术架构解析:本地化微信聊天记录提取与数据主权实现方案

WeChatMsg技术架构解析:本地化微信聊天记录提取与数据主权实现方案 【免费下载链接】WeChatMsg 提取微信聊天记录,将其导出成HTML、Word、CSV文档永久保存,对聊天记录进行分析生成年度聊天报告 项目地址: https://gitcode.com/GitHub_Trend…

作者头像 李华
网站建设 2026/5/12 19:07:24

票据的采集,更新业务 todo 抽空迁移并废弃掉

采集过程 用户校验 参数校验部分 代码号码开票日期校验码(普票或电票必须)金额 是否有id,有id说明已存在,则应该是更新(该用更新接口)如果能查到,说明重复采集了查不到,新增存库

作者头像 李华
网站建设 2026/5/12 19:04:08

Perplexity AI集成开发工具:MCP协议与零成本API实战指南

1. 项目概述:将Perplexity AI深度集成到你的开发工作流 如果你是一名开发者,或者经常需要处理信息检索、代码问题排查、技术方案调研这类工作,那么你肯定对“搜索”这件事又爱又恨。爱的是它能瞬间连接海量知识,恨的是在IDE和浏览…

作者头像 李华